If the bookkeeper is employed by the company, she will be paid according to the employer’s payroll policies and cycle. The Bureau of Labor Statistics reported that bookkeepers overall earned a median annual salary of ​$45,560​, or ​$21.90​ per hour, as of 2021. If the bookkeeper is working as https://intuit-payroll.org/top-15-bookkeeping-software-for-startups/ an independent contractor, she will invoice the business for the services performed and the client will remit payment in accordance to its contractor payment policy. Financial Post indicated in 2020 that virtual bookkeeper salary for skilled independent contractors was around ​$60​ per hour.

  • The way a virtual bookkeeper works with their clients is by giving them online access to their financial accounts, documents, and server, in some instances.

Rather than sit-down meetings and reams of hard copy paperwork, everything can be done remotely and flexibly. The benefit of using a virtual bookkeeper as a business owner is that it is often cheaper than hiring someone local to work on-site. The bookkeeper can be paid as a contractor and work as little or as much as the business needs.
